What are the important dates for this form in 2024 and 2025?

For 2024, the due dates for Form 941 are: April 30 for Quarter 1, July 31 for Quarter 2, October 31 for Quarter 3, and January 31, 2025, for Quarter 4. Stay updated for any changes to these deadlines.

What is the purpose of this form?

Form 941 serves the purpose of reporting taxes withheld on employee wages for businesses. It includes detailed information about income tax, social security tax, and Medicare tax paid throughout the quarter. Timely submission of Form 941 is critical for maintaining compliance with federal tax obligations.

Tell me about this form and its components and fields line-by-line.

Form 941 includes various fields necessary for tax reporting, such as employer information, employee wage details, and tax calculations.
fields
  • 1. Employer Identification Number (EIN): A unique identifier assigned to businesses for tax purposes.
  • 2. Number of Employees: Total count of employees who received wages during the quarter.
  • 3. Wages, Tips, and Other Compensation: Total earnings subject to federal income taxes.
  • 4. Federal Income Tax Withheld: Amount of federal income tax withheld from employees' wages.
  • 5. Taxable Social Security Wages: Total amount of wages subject to social security tax.
  • 6. Medicare Tax: Total wages subject to Medicare tax.

What happens if I fail to submit this form?

Failure to submit Form 941 on time can lead to penalties and interest on unpaid taxes. Additionally, businesses may be subject to legal action or audits by the IRS for non-compliance.

  • Penalties for Late Filing: Businesses may incur penalties determined by the IRS based on the amount overdue.
  • Interest Accrued: Interest may accumulate on unpaid tax balances, increasing financial liability.
  • IRS Audits: Failure to file may trigger an audit, leading to further scrutiny of financial records.
